Funny Folks for January 23, 1875, contained a parody, in ten verses, on The Voyage; the first and last verse only are given, as the rest are of little interest:—

THE EXCURSION TRAIN.

We left behind the painted buoy

That tosses at the harbour mouth;

And madly danced our hearts with joy

As fast we floated to the South.
